Kalanidhi Dance presents, Sagarika, a brand new original work, born of a collaboration with Sharmila Biswas, one of India’s most esteemed classical dance practitioners. Sagarika, or Sea-Maiden, is based on a poem by Nobel Laureate Rabindranath Tagore. Tagore’s poem imagines a primordial sea that opens to make way for the earth and imagines the relationship between sea and earth to be akin to that of mother and child. Inspired by this allegory, Ms. Biswas’s choreography explores conceptual questions relating to humanity’s place in the scheme of creation, to create a contemporary piece on the forefront of the field.
